SB 1516: Library Bond (2008)
Summary
Senate Bill 1516 places a $4 billion General Obligation Bond measure on the 2010 statewide general election ballot to fund library construction and renovation.
Proceeds from bond sales will be deposited into the California Public Library Construction and Renovation Fund of 2010 and then made available, through the State Librarian, for grants to local entities for:
• Construction of new library facilities
• Land acquisition for remodeling or rehabilitation projects
• Remodeling or rehabilitation of existing library facilities
• Purchase and installment of furnishings and equipment
• Payments to architects, engineers or other professionals instrumental in construction or remodel projects
